I have found similar postings for this issue and the resolution for them doesn't seem to apply in this case.
The user is testing Active sync devices on his account. He has three. Two androids and one iphone. No matter what he does, he is not able to remove the iphone through owa. He has reconfigured it and owa displays a new device in addition to the old one. So now he is up to three iphone devices and two androids.
The devices show up in EAC as well as owa. If you try to remove them from either interface, you get an error. (cannot be found, deletion pending and then fails. Have tried disabling active sync for devices, for ActiveSync, re-enabling, no change)
Checking in AD, the iphone devices do not exist.
I found another post that references using mfcmapi to remove the items from the users mailbox. After expanding the root folder, the "exchangesyncdata" does not appear. I'm wondering if this was moved to a new location in an Exchange 2013 mailbox?
